The Fijian Government in conjunction with the Biosecurity Authority of Fiji is reviewing the fees and charges under the regulation to directly address the ease of doing business for services provided by BAF.
This was announced by the Minister for Economy Aiyaz Sayed-Khaiyum during the national budget address last week Friday.
He said a change for the Rapid Risk Analysis of Pathways (RAP) had been introduced to improve the timeline of market access by the importer.
“New products from existing pathways will be easy to import through the introduction of RAP,” said Mr Sayed-Khaiyum.
